在数字化时代,数据存储和文件分享变得越来越重要。很多用户希望寻找一种既方便又可靠的方式来存储和分享文件。GitHub作为一个强大的代码托管平台,不仅可以用来管理代码,还可以作为一种云盘使用,特别是对于webadv用户来说。本文将详细介绍如何使用GitHub当作webadv云盘。
GitHub简介
GitHub是一个基于Git的版本控制系统,它允许开发者托管代码并进行版本管理。用户可以在GitHub上创建仓库,在这些仓库中存储各种文件和项目。由于GitHub提供了免费的公共仓库和私有仓库,用户可以灵活选择适合自己的存储方案。
为什么选择GitHub作为云盘
使用GitHub作为云盘有以下几个优势:
- 版本控制:GitHub可以记录文件的历史版本,方便用户回溯和管理。
- 在线访问:用户可以随时随地通过互联网访问自己的文件。
- 共享方便:用户可以轻松分享文件或项目给他人。
- 集成化:GitHub支持各种工具的集成,用户可以在开发过程中直接使用。
如何在GitHub上创建云盘
第一步:创建一个GitHub账户
- 访问 GitHub官方网站。
- 点击右上角的“Sign up”注册一个新账户。
- 根据提示填写用户名、电子邮件和密码,完成注册。
第二步:创建一个新的仓库
- 登录后,点击右上角的“+”号,选择“New repository”。
- 填写仓库名称,可以设置为“my-cloud”或者其他喜欢的名称。
- 选择“Public”或“Private”来决定仓库的可见性,建议使用Private以保护文件隐私。
- 点击“Create repository”完成创建。
第三步:上传文件到仓库
- 在新创建的仓库页面,点击“Add file”按钮。
- 选择“Upload files”。
- 拖拽文件或者点击选择文件,选择你想要上传的文件。
- 添加提交信息,点击“Commit changes”完成上传。
使用GitHub管理文件
在GitHub上,你可以对文件进行多种管理操作:
- 创建文件夹:可以在仓库中创建多个文件夹,以便分类管理文件。
- 编辑文件:直接在网页上编辑文件,方便快捷。
- 删除文件:可以随时删除不需要的文件。
- 查看历史:查看文件的历史版本,恢复到之前的版本。
GitHub与其他云盘的对比
在选择云盘时,GitHub和其他云盘(如Google Drive, Dropbox)有一些显著的区别:
- 存储类型:GitHub主要用于存储代码和文档,而其他云盘支持更为多样的文件类型。
- 版本控制:GitHub具有强大的版本控制功能,而其他云盘的版本管理通常不如GitHub灵活。
- 使用场景:GitHub更适合技术用户和开发者,而其他云盘则更适合普通用户和团队合作。
常见问题解答 (FAQ)
1. 使用GitHub当云盘会有什么限制吗?
使用GitHub作为云盘,主要有以下限制:
- 文件大小:单个文件的最大限制为100MB,建议使用Git LFS(Large File Storage)处理大文件。
- 流量限制:公共仓库会受到一定的流量限制,频繁的下载可能会影响访问速度。
2. 如何保护我的文件隐私?
建议将你的仓库设置为Private,这样只有你和你指定的用户能够访问该仓库。同时,定期检查仓库的访问权限也是保护隐私的重要手段。
3. GitHub云盘适合哪些类型的文件?
虽然GitHub主要用于代码和文档,但也可以存储一些轻量级的文件,例如:
- 文本文件(.txt, .md)
- 图片文件(.png, .jpg)
- 配置文件(.json, .yaml)
4. 如何下载我在GitHub上存储的文件?
在你的仓库中,可以点击“Code”按钮,选择“Download ZIP”将整个仓库下载到本地,也可以直接点击每个文件旁的“Download”链接下载特定文件。
5. 可以将GitHub与其他云服务结合使用吗?
当然可以!GitHub可以与其他云服务(如Dropbox, Google Drive)集成使用,通过一些自动化工具(如Zapier, IFTTT)可以实现文件的同步与备份。
结语
通过以上步骤和信息,您应该能够顺利将GitHub作为您的webadv云盘使用。无论是管理代码还是分享文件,GitHub都能提供一个可靠的平台。希望您能充分利用这个工具,提升工作和学习效率!